Lot 337 chestnut colt Circus Maximus – Catch Your Idol (Zabeel) $160,000 (draft: Curraghmore Stud)
Te Akau has been an advocate for the strong bodied progeny of Circus Maximus (Galileo), and included among their purchases is Towering Vision, who came from last to win the Eagle Technology 3YO 1600 metres on 1 January at Ellerslie, and now on a path towards the $1.25m Trackside New Zealand Derby (Gr. 1, 2400m).
Towering Vision also provided the first stakes win for his young sire, when winning the Waikato Equine Veterinary Centre Stakes (Listed, 1400m) with a tough performance as a two-year-old.
By the greatest sire of stakes winners in the world, Galileo (Sadler’s Wells), Circus Maximus was a Champion Miler and triple Group One winner that won the St James Palace Stakes (Gr. 1, 1600m), a noted stallion-making race, and like Champion racehorse Frankel (Galileo) before him, he also won the Queen Anne Stakes (Gr. 1, 1600m) at Royal Ascot.
Dam Catch Your Idol was a winner over 1850 metres in Australia, and by the highest stakes producing stallion in NZ history, Zabeel (Sir Tristram), who serves so well the trilogy of breed shaping stallions in New Zealand: Savabeel – Zabeel – Sir Tristram.
Within the New Zealand breeding industry, going back to the introduction of Sir Tristram in 1976, you cannot beat the influence of the blood, going forward through Zabeel and Savabeel, and the host of incredible racehorses they have produced.
The dam of five-time winner Faraglioni (El Roca), multiple placed at Group One & Group Two levels, Catch Your Idol has proven herself as broodmare with five individual winners of 14 races.
The family goes back to Victoria Derby (Gr. 1, 2500m) winner Hit The Roof (Maroof), a son of third dam Good News (Don’t Forget Me), and the pedigree of the colt suggests that he too will develop into a miler to staying type.
“He’s a really athletic individual by the exciting sire Circus Maximus, who was an incredible racehorse in Europe, and we’re very fortunate to be able to buy his progeny in New Zealand,” said David Ellis.
“He’s a great mover, we’re bullish on the sire through the deeds of Towering Vision, who is equal favourite for the Derby, and there in the no doubt that this colt has the right pedigree for classic staying races.”
The colt has a nicely balanced bloodline cross to immortal sire Northern Dancer, in the sire lines of both Circus Maximus and Catch Your Idol.
